Bream's career in journalism began to flourish after she joined the Fox News Channel in 2007. Initially based in Washington, D.C., she worked as a correspondent covering the Supreme Court. This role provided her with invaluable experience, establishing her as a respected voice on legal matters. Her deep understanding of legal intricacies, combined with her ability to communicate complex information clearly, quickly set her apart. In her tenure at Fox News, Bream has ascended to the role of Chief Legal Correspondent and anchor of "Fox News @ Night."

But before the television, there was law. Before her television career, Bream practiced corporate law, specializing in employment and labor, in Tampa, Florida. The story of Shannon Bream is also intertwined with her personal life, particularly her marriage to Sheldon Bream. They were married on December 30, 1995, and their bond has endured for over two decades. Sheldon, a former college athlete, faced and overcame a diagnosis of a brain tumor at the age of 24. Together, they have faced life's challenges with mutual support and understanding. While they don't have children, their family includes their beloved dogs, Jasper, Biscuit, and Oscar, whom they cherish. The narrative surrounding Shannon Bream also includes details of her upbringing in Sanford, Florida. Born to Marie Norris and Ed Depuy, she was the only daughter in her family. Her father, a U.S. Marine and later a Leon County Commissioner, sadly passed away in April 2013. Her mother, a teacher, provided her with a solid grounding and a sense of community.
